Abstract

The interaction of amidrazones and isocyanate esters in dimethylformamide produces good yields of 4-substituted-1-imidoylsemicarbazides. They are unaffected by acids, but are cyclised to 3-alkyl (or aryl)-1, 2, 4-triazol-3-ones or their 4-substituted analogues in alkaline media.
